Sprocket Sizing Guide: Finding Your Perfect Ratio

Selecting the correct sprocket size requires balancing your riding style with mechanical limitations. The Z400 typically ships with a 14T front/41T rear configuration, while the ZX-4R often uses 14T/42T. Going -1 tooth in front creates noticeable acceleration gains, while +2 in the rear enhances low-end power without significantly sacrificing top speed.

Calculating Final Drive Ratio

Divide the rear sprocket tooth count by the front sprocket’s to determine your final drive ratio. Higher ratios mean quicker acceleration but lower top speed. Remember that extreme sprocket changes may require chain length adjustments and can affect speedometer accuracy.

Professional Installation Techniques

Proper sprocket installation ensures longevity and safety. Begin by securing the motorcycle on a paddock stand and removing the rear wheel. Use a torque wrench to fasten the front sprocket nut to factory specifications—over-tightening can damage output shaft bearings. When installing the rear sprocket, check for proper alignment and replace the chain if it shows significant wear.

Tools and Safety Precautions

Essential tools include a quality torque wrench, chain breaker tool, and motorcycle stand. Always wear protective gloves and eyewear when handling chains. Consider applying thread locker to sprocket bolts and verify all components are securely fastened before test rides.

What Is Luosifen Made Of?

Luosifen combines rice noodles, river snails, and a rich broth infused with spices like star anise and chili oil. Its signature pungent aroma comes from fermented bamboo shoots, adding depth to each slurp. This dish balances sour, spicy, and savory notes for a truly addictive meal.

Fuel Types and Selection Tips

Gas stations typically offer several fuel grades: regular, mid-grade, and premium. Each is formulated with different octane ratings to suit various engine types. Using the correct fuel can optimize performance and prevent engine knocking. If you’re unsure which to choose, check your vehicle’s manual or consult the on-site attendant.

Unleaded vs Diesel Fuel

Unleaded gasoline is designed for most personal vehicles, while diesel fuel powers heavier engines like those in trucks and some SUVs. Using the wrong type can cause severe engine damage. Always verify the fuel type your vehicle requires before filling up.

Chemical Properties of Arabinose

Arabinose belongs to the aldopentose family, characterized by a five-carbon backbone. Its molecular formula is C5H10O5, and it commonly exists in L-arabinose and D-arabinose stereoisomers. The sugar exhibits high solubility in water and stability under moderate temperatures, making it suitable for food processing and laboratory applications.

Structural Isomers and Biological Relevance

L-arabinose is prevalent in plant hemicellulose, contributing to dietary fiber benefits. Its ability to inhibit intestinal sucrase enzymes supports its role in managing blood sugar levels, a key focus in functional food development.
